**TICKET: Graphspire plugin registry vault locked**

Summary: Graphspire, our dependency graph visualizer, exposes a signing vault that external plugin authors use to publish layout extensions. After last night's key-rotation job failed midway, the vault entered a locked state and all plugin publishes now return a sealed-vault error. We have verified the underlying data is intact; no resubmission is required once access is restored. Plugin authors who need to publish urgently can reopen the vault using the recovery passphrase below.

vault phrase of kawep-tahog = ulaix-briath

**Vendor note: Inkmill markdown pipeline**

Rendering for Parchway docs is outsourced to Inkmill under an annual contract, renewing each March. They handle sanitization and PDF export; we own the upload queue. SLA: 4-hour response on rendering failures. Escalate only after two failed retries. Their support desk is reachable at the address below.

billing contact of hahaf-baguf = zorael.tammir.jorius@sivrelhq.internal

# Revised Commission Scheme — Managers Only

Effective next quarter, Korvane Industries moves from flat 6% commission to tiered rates: 4% to quota, 8% above, 12% past 130%. Multi-year deals on the Pellis platform earn a 1.5x multiplier; discounts beyond 15% zero out the multiplier. Clawback window extends to 90 days. Do not circulate below manager level until the all-hands. Incoming director should note the scheme was designed with a specific strategic aim, summarised confidentially below.

board note of fahif-yahog: Gross margin on Wenath came in at 10 percent against a plan of 5 percent. Only 3 of the 100 pilot accounts renewed Wenath, so a churn review is set for July 15.

Alert: BILLWORKER_BLUEGREEN_DRIFT

Fires when the blue and green pools of the Ledgerline billing worker diverge for more than ten minutes during a deploy. For plugin authors: your hooks run on both pools during cutover, so side effects must be idempotent. If this alert fires while your plugin is active, traffic freezes on the blue pool and your hook output is quarantined pending review. Cutover mechanics, idempotency requirements, and the plugin certification steps are described here:

wiki page, tahaf-tajog: https://jira.ordindyn.corp/pipeline